Effects of Bacteriophage Preparation on Growth Performance,Immune Function and Antioxidant Capacity of Growing Male Minks
The aim of this study was to investigate the effects of bacteriophage preparation on growth perform-ance,immune function and antioxidant capacity of growing male minks.Ninety-six 75-day-old growing male minks were randomly divided into 6 groups with 8 replicates per group and 2 minks per replicate.Minks in the control group were fed a basal diet,and others in experimental groups were fed the basal diets supplemented with 175,350,525,700 and 875 mg/kg bacteriophage preparation(Escherichia coli bacteriophage and Sal-monella bacteriophage compound preparation,their ratio was 1∶1,and the total titer was 109 PFU/g),respec-tively.The experiment lasted for 8 weeks,and was divided into period Ⅰ(weeks 1 to 4)and period Ⅱ(weeks 5 to 8).The result showed as follows:1)compared with the control group,dietary 525,700 and 875 mg/kg bacteriophage preparation significantly decreased the feed to gain ratio(F/G)and diarrhea rate during experimental period Ⅰ,experimental period Ⅱ and whole experimental period(P<0.05 or P<0.01),significantly increased the average daily gain(ADG)during experimental period Ⅱ and whole experimental period(P<0.01).2)Compared with the control group,dietary 700 and 875 mg/kg bacteriophage preparation significantly increased the contents of immunoglobulin A(IgA),immunoglobulin G(IgG)and immunoglobu-lin M(IgM)in serum(P<0.05 or P<0.01).3)Compared with the control group,dietary 700 mg/kg bacte-riophage preparation significantly decreased the serum malondialdehyde(MDA)content(P<0.05),signifi-cantly increased the serum glutathione peroxidase(GSH-Px)activity and total antioxidant capacity(T-AOC)(P<0.05).4)Compared with the control group,dietary 875 mg/kg bacteriophage preparation significantly in-creased the spleen index and intestine to body ratio(I/B)(P<0.05),dietary 525 and 700 mg/kg bacterio-phage preparation significantly increased the kidney index(P<0.05).5)The quadratic curves were fitted by dietary bacteriophage preparation supplemental level with F/G during whole experimental period,diarrhea rate during whole experimental period,serum IgG content,and obtained that the dietary optimum supplemental lev-el of bacteriophage preparation for growing male minks was 777.90 to 942.21 mg/kg.Comprehensive consid-eration,it is suggested that the dietary supplemental level of bacteriophage preparation for growing male minks is 847.20 mg/kg.[Chinese Journal of Animal Nutrition,2024,36(11):7284-7293]
